
Gavin Normand focused on back-end reliability for the sandboxnu/good-dog-licensing repository, addressing a critical issue in the EmailService component. He restored the actual email sending flow by removing placeholder delays and commented-out code, re-enabling the mailerSend.email.send method. By reinstating validation for sender addresses and API keys, he ensured that only properly configured requests could trigger notifications. Working primarily with TypeScript and leveraging his expertise in back-end development and email services, Gavin’s fix improved the reliability of user notifications when licenses are issued or updated. His targeted work addressed a key production concern, enhancing communication stability for end users.
